Output ba40055160d15c3b36f799590310c1dd386975eecf27e212cea7c6a51fee7a59:11

value
698736184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3f857bf26492e380c3bc3331139277dff29368 OP_EQUAL
address
MEm31N2LE5UxVCLzqGJqhjwu5DnHc8AVWy
transaction
ba40055160d15c3b36f799590310c1dd386975eecf27e212cea7c6a51fee7a59
spent
true